Yup have windtamer in 4 and 6lb, Nanobraid 3lb and Nanofil 4 and 6lb currently using with all my crappie rigs. There are also some cheap brand that sell 4lb but look more like 6-8lb. Bass is not line shy no need to go super thin braid, you would loose more fish and lures with that type line for bass fishing. 
I only use this small super line for only one thing in mind,  casting distance which I need the most since I fish from shore.
